Alvin Lewis, also known as Al Lewis, (November 12, 1942 – January 31, 2018) was an American professional boxer who fought in the heavyweight division under the alias "Al "Blue" Lewis". A powerful adversary to many, "Blue" Lewis beat: Cleveland Williams, Billy Joiner, Bill McMurray, Eduardo Corletti, and Bob Stallings.

Lewis was a long-term sparring partner of Muhammad Ali and is mentioned in Ali's autobiography. He also sparred with, among others, George Foreman before the champion's match with Ken Norton.
